1. Understand the reasons for frequency limit
As a global social media platform, TikTok has set access frequency limits to protect system stability and prevent malicious attacks. When a user attempts to register an account multiple times in a short period of time, quickly switches accounts, or performs frequent operations, the system will automatically trigger a frequent access prompt. This measure is designed to protect the platform from automated robots and abuse, ensuring that users can use TikTok in a safe environment.
2. Solution
1. Wait for a while and try again
When you encounter the "Access frequency too frequent" prompt, the simplest solution is to pause the operation and try again after a period of time. The waiting time depends on the specific situation and may vary from a few minutes to a few hours. This period of time helps the system reset and reduce the restrictions caused by frequent operations.
2. Use a stable Internet connection
A good network connection is one of the keys to avoiding frequent access issues. It is recommended to ensure that you are using a stable, high-speed Internet connection and avoid frequent registration attempts when the network is unstable or the signal is weak. An unstable network connection may cause the system to mistake it for frequent access, thus triggering restrictions.
3. Change the network environment or device
If possible, try changing the network environment or using a different device to register. Sometimes, a specific network environment or device may have been marked as abnormal by the system, and changing it may bypass the restriction.

5. Comply with TikTok’s Terms of Use
Complying with TikTok's usage regulations and community guidelines is also an important way to avoid frequent access issues. Avoiding the use of automated tools or scripts for large-scale operations and maintaining a reasonable frequency of use and behavior will help reduce the risk of being misjudged by the system.
6. Contact TikTok Support
If you have tried all of the above and still cannot resolve the issue, it is recommended to contact TikTok's customer support team. Provide a detailed description of the problem and account information, and customer service may be able to identify and resolve frequent access restrictions more quickly.
